Cucumbers German F1 is a hybrid, bred in Holland. Has both positive and negative qualities, marked by truck farmers.

From positive it is possible to note that Herman F1 early begins to bear fruit. Hybrid refers to the ultra-fast-ridden. It will take less than 40 days from the time of emergence and you can pick the first fruits.

The pluses also include high yields. If you follow the farming techniques of cultivation, you can get more than 20 kg from 1 sq. Km. m.

The fruiting period lasts from the beginning of June to the middle of September.

You can also note the ideal size of the greenery - 8-10 cm, excellent taste without bitterness. It is a good variety for canning, pickling. The presentation persists for several weeks.

Hermann F1 - a hybrid beam, that is, the fruit tied with bundles of 6-7 pieces, parthenocarpic - does not require pollination by bees..

An important advantage of this variety is their resistance to various diseases, such as mosaic, powdery mildew, fusarium wilt.

Unfortunately, Hermann F1 has several disadvantages. They are not many, but they are better to know, so as not to be disappointed with growing.

Firstly, if you are going to grow them through seedlings, then know that this hybrid does not tolerate the pick, the transplant - the plant is weak in the seedling stage. Therefore, plant German seeds immediately in sufficiently spacious containers, so that the root system is not damaged when planted in a permanent place. Otherwise the seedling will be ill for a long time, it can not take root.

Secondly, this hybrid is unstable to frost, so it is recommended to plant them in the ground at an air temperature of not less than 18 degrees.

Thirdly, Hermann cucumbers are amenable to massive rust damage - because of this, sometimes only the first crop can be harvested. Rust is a fungal disease. Well showed in the fight against these fungus drug Funadozol. Do not wait for the first signs of the appearance of this disease - even Funadozol can not cope with it when the process has already gone. Try to get ahead. If spring or early summer are rainy, treat until the ovaries appear. And if the cucumbers are already hanging, then I warn that it is possible to consume them after the treatment with Funadazole only after 7 days.
